AI编程
文章平均质量分 71
terryso
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
BMad v6实战第三弹:对抗式代码审查(Code Review)
(永远不要接受「看起来不错」)。它被设计成一个持有批判立场的高级开发者,必须在每次审查中找出 3-10 个具体问题。✅ 任务标记为[x]的真的是完成了✅ 验收标准真的是实现了,不是糊弄✅ 代码质量经得起安全、性能、可维护性考验代码审查的本质是质量门禁。在 AI 辅助开发时代,我们不再需要人类做机械性的代码扫描,但我们需要一个永不妥协的质量守门员。✅不讲人情:只认代码,不认关系✅事必躬亲:逐文件验证,不遗漏✅知识驱动:结合架构文档、项目上下文综合判断✅可自愈:发现问题时可以自动修复。原创 2026-01-02 00:31:09 · 916 阅读 · 0 评论 -
BMad v6实战过程全公开:32场对话揭秘人机协作怎么搞?
这 32 个对话,是我探索"人机协作开发"的第一步,也是 BMad v6 方法论的一次完整实践。如果你也在路上,欢迎交流。你在开发中有和 AI 协作的经验吗?欢迎在评论区分享你的故事。原创 2025-12-28 09:31:44 · 694 阅读 · 0 评论 -
AutoQA-Agent:用 Markdown 写验收用例,AI + Playwright 跑起来,跑通还能导出成 Playwright Test
摘要:AutoQA-Agent是一个开源CLI工具,采用"文档即测试"理念,用Markdown编写测试用例,通过Claude Agent SDK和Playwright实现自动化测试。核心功能包括:自然语言描述测试步骤、自动执行与自愈、失败上下文记录、支持导出Playwright测试代码。解决了传统UI自动化测试维护成本高、脚本不友好、排查困难等问题。工具已实现核心功能,包括运行管理、断言自愈、IR记录和代码导出,并支持环境变量注入。原创 2025-12-19 11:22:25 · 617 阅读 · 0 评论 -
我在Claude Code状态栏养了一个电子宠物
摘要:我开发了一个ClaudeCode状态栏电子宠物ccpet,它会根据token使用情况变化状态。宠物能量会随时间衰减(3天不喂食会死亡),需通过消耗token喂养。不同能量状态显示不同表情:(^_^)开心、(o_o)饥饿、(u_u)生病、(x_x)死亡。死亡后所有数据重置。配置简单,只需修改settings.json文件。宠物能跨会话保持状态,并实时显示token统计。这个创意工具能激励开发者保持活跃编码。项目已开源在GitHub。原创 2025-08-23 16:25:31 · 292 阅读 · 0 评论 -
ccshell – 基于Claude Code的自然语言Shell命令工具
ccshell是一个用自然语言执行Shell命令的工具,解决了忘记命令语法的痛点。用户只需输入任务描述,如"查找所有大于100MB的文件"或"转换HEIC照片为JPEG",它就能自动生成并执行对应命令。基于Claude Code CLI实现,具有自动安装工具、显示进度、处理复杂任务等功能。支持npx直接试用,专为macOS优化但可扩展跨平台。采用三层执行策略:本地命令→工具安装→自定义脚本。项目已开源在GitHub。原创 2025-08-12 16:05:59 · 319 阅读 · 0 评论 -
BMAD-METHOD:让一个人顶一个敏捷团队的 AI 驱动开发框架
(Breakthrough Method of Agile AI-Driven Development)是一个突破性的 AI 代理编排框架,它的核心理念是通过专门的 AI 代理来模拟完整的敏捷开发团队,让一个人就能拥有整个团队的力量。但是,组建一个完整的敏捷团队需要产品经理、架构师、开发人员、测试人员、UX 设计师等各种角色,对于个人开发者或小团队来说,这几乎是不可能的任务。不是简单的 AI 助手,而是严格遵循敏捷方法论的完整流程,每个 AI 代理都有明确的职责和交付物。原创 2025-07-14 23:14:51 · 3505 阅读 · 0 评论 -
Claude Code 深夜也要加班?这个神器让 AI 自动续命!
摘要: Claude Auto Resume 是一款解决 Claude Code 使用限制的开源工具,可自动检测限制时间并恢复任务执行。核心功能包括智能倒计时(如"恢复倒计时 02:15:30...")、零干预自动续接任务,支持通过简单命令(如claude-auto-resume "实现登录功能")继续工作。需注意其自动执行特性,建议仅在开发环境使用并做好备份。适用于经常遭遇深夜使用限制的开发者,项目已开源,支持Linux/macOS,仅200行代码实现无依赖自动化续原创 2025-07-08 03:44:24 · 1094 阅读 · 0 评论 -
来个好玩的,用手机随时随地指挥你的 Cursor!
Cursor远程控制解决方案是一个开源项目,旨在让用户通过手机随时随地控制Mac上的Cursor应用。该项目利用Supabase的实时数据库和AppleScript,实现手机与Cursor之间的无缝连接。用户只需在手机浏览器中输入指令,指令会通过Supabase实时传输到Mac,并由AppleScript执行。原创 2025-05-21 11:26:53 · 549 阅读 · 0 评论 -
告别脆弱的 Playwright 测试:为什么基于 YAML 的测试是未来趋势
摘要:本文介绍了一种基于YAML的Playwright测试新范式,专为Claude Code和Playwright MCP设计。传统JavaScript测试存在冗长、维护困难等问题,而YAML测试方案通过自然语言步骤、可复用组件和环境变量配置,使测试代码更简洁易读。该方案降低了技术门槛,让非开发人员也能编写测试,同时保持了强大功能。案例数据显示,采用YAML测试后代码量减少90%,培训时间从3天缩短至30分钟。文章详细解析了技术架构、使用方法和优势,展示了这种AI驱动的测试方法如何提高团队效率。原创 2025-06-16 09:41:41 · 1334 阅读 · 0 评论
分享